A well known publisher here, Bentley, is bringing out a Boxster maintenance manual set shortly, some time this month. It is expected be US$100 and is said to be excellent. Sign up here to be notified when it is available http://www.bentleypublishers.com/product.htm?code=pb04

There are also Porsche work shop manuals you can buy online for US$20 for download, it is a 600mb download in PDF format but isn't great. They are ok but hard to follow and don't go in to detail. Worth $20 maybe but not much more.

Having said that they seem to have disappeared from the web site, they were on here http://www.workshopmanuals.co.uk/workshop_manuals/cars/index.html but people have said they were unofficial, maybe Porsche shut them off. The ones on ebay are the same as these and in my opinion are not worth the money.

I have no affiliation with any of these, just passing on the links and what I have heard.
